Every day, we walk past and sit on park benches, many of which have plaques dedicated to departed loved ones. Recently, I realised that I had never taken the time to read these inscriptions properly. As both an artist and a genealogist, I thought it would be an interesting project to photograph each bench and research the lives of the individuals commemorated on them.
My first project was quite significant; it involved a large line of over 100 benches in Leigh-On-Sea, all overlooking the sea. I completed this in three phases. After finishing that project, I began to notice dedicated benches in various locations everywhere!
